Output e51413b3c8a9dbf558b3bbe689ce35916676f7646dfd3c69fc601767b77516bc:0

value
50553
script pubkey
OP_0 OP_PUSHBYTES_20 6959c042c164c687fff8109a3b85cd69624c3eaa
address
tb1qd9vuqskpvnrg0llczzdrhpwdd93yc0422jz335
transaction
e51413b3c8a9dbf558b3bbe689ce35916676f7646dfd3c69fc601767b77516bc
confirmations
68842
spent
true